1. Embrace Warm Lighting

The right lighting can drastically alter the mood of any room. To achieve a cozy atmosphere in your apartment, prioritize soft, ambient lighting over harsh overhead fixtures. Use a combination of floor lamps, table lamps, and string lights to create layers of illumination that enhance the space’s warmth. Opt for bulbs with a warm color temperature—between 2700K and 3000K—to evoke a serene and inviting ambiance. Dimmable options are ideal for adjusting brightness according to the time of day and the mood you wish to set.

2. Layer Textures and Fabrics

A tactile approach to decor is key when considering cozy atmosphere ideas for apartments. Incorporate a variety of fabrics, such as plush throws, knitted blankets, and velvet cushions, to add depth and softness to your living space. Rugs are another fantastic way to introduce texture; they not only provide visual interest but also insulate against the chill of hard floors. Consider layering rugs with complementary colors or patterns to add an extra dimension of comfort.

3. Opt for Earthy and Neutral Color Palettes

Color plays a vital role in crafting a peaceful, welcoming space. For a truly warm apartment environment, focus on earthy tones like soft beiges, rich browns, and muted greens. These hues evoke a natural, tranquil atmosphere that is both relaxing and timeless. While bold colors can energize a room, they might detract from the calming environment you’re aiming to create. Instead, use them sparingly—perhaps as accent pieces or in artwork—to maintain a harmonious aesthetic.

4. Introduce Natural Elements

Bringing elements of nature indoors can significantly contribute to making your apartment feel inviting. Houseplants not only purify the air but also add a lively, organic touch to your decor. Choose low-maintenance varieties like succulents, pothos, or snake plants, which thrive in various lighting conditions. Incorporating natural materials like wooden furniture, wicker baskets, and stone accessories further enhances the connection to nature and fosters a cozy, grounded atmosphere.

8. Use Scents to Set the Mood

The sense of smell has a powerful effect on our perception of space. To enhance your cozy apartment atmosphere, consider using scented candles, essential oil diffusers, or incense. Scents like vanilla, lavender, and sandalwood are particularly effective at creating a soothing environment. You can also switch up fragrances according to the seasons—citrus and floral notes in spring and summer, and warmer, spicier scents like cinnamon and clove in fall and winter.

9. Incorporate Soft Sounds

Sound is an often-overlooked element of interior design, yet it plays a significant role in creating a cozy apartment atmosphere. Gentle background music, the subtle crackle of a fireplace, or the sound of water from a small indoor fountain can all contribute to a serene environment. Even the placement of soft textiles like curtains and cushions can help absorb noise, reducing echoes and enhancing the acoustic comfort of your space.
